The slim affords a smooth, unfussed shave at any setting and I'd describe it as a civilised, easy to get to know razor with no quirks or ' getting to know you ' features. If you have large handies it's a fairly small, light neat piece of kit which may be just too short handled for your taste. A good one is a keeper and you can always pretend you're Sir Sean being James Bond every time you use it.

I have tried a Fatboy and didn't like it; too bulky and pig ugly imo. I have a Slim and find it ok to use but no better than many other razors. Problems with Fatboys and Slims is that they're old and have many moving parts so more likely to be worn out or gunked up with soap etc. over the years. They're difficult to get, expensive and a lottery whether you get a good one or not.
Similar for ATT, they're expensive and you may not get on with them. Plus you have to decide if you like the M, R or H plates, open or closed comb, or even slant. Could end up costing a lot.
Personally I'd recommend a Progress (or even Parker Variant, which seems to be a clone). I've always got good shaves from my Progress.
I'd also recommend the Rockwell 6S, although I've not tried one, it gives you many choices in aggression and many people swear by it.
